The section used to discussed $gitweb_export_ok and $gitweb_list, but
gitweb Perl code does not have such variables (this likely hangs over
from GITWEB_EXPORT_OK and GITWEB_LIST respectively). Fix the section to
spell $export_ok and $projects_list like the rest of the document.
